City Guide
Saraktashskiy Rayon, Orenburg, Russia
Overview
Saraktashskiy Rayon is a rural district in Orenburg region, Russia, noted for its picturesque steppe landscapes and welcoming small settlements. The area is characterized by a relaxed provincial atmosphere, historic churches, and local festivals celebrating agricultural traditions.
Best Time to Visit
May-September for mild weather and green countryside
Local Tips
Most people speak Russian; cash is more widely accepted than cards. Public transport is limited, so consider renting a car or using local taxis.
Cultural Etiquette
Dress modestly, especially when visiting churches. Tipping is customary but not obligatory (5-10% in restaurants). Greet locals with a polite nod or handshake.
Safety Warnings
Crime rates are low, but take care at night in secluded areas. Watch for stray dogs in villages and be aware of seasonal road conditions.
